Comets May Have Delivered Life-Sustaining Water to Earth

A new study reanalyzing data from the European Space Agency's Rosetta mission suggests that comets, particularly Jupiter-family comets like Comet 67P, may have played a significant role in delivering water to Earth. The study found that the deuterium-to-hydrogen (D/H) ratio of Comet 67P is closer to Earth's than previously thought, indicating that comets could have been major contributors to Earth's water supply. This challenges earlier beliefs that comets were unlikely sources of Earth's water.

"Dark Comets: Ancient Cosmic Ice May Have Delivered Earth's Water"

An international team of astronomers has identified dark comets, which may constitute up to 60% of near-Earth objects, as potential carriers of water to Earth in the distant past. These objects, originating from the asteroid belt between Mars and Jupiter, contain small amounts of ice and could have contributed to seeding Earth with water and possibly life-essential molecules.
